      Sec. 12-125a. Waiver of taxes on certain property held by suppliers of water. 
Any municipality may, upon approval by its legislative body, or by the board of selectmen in any town in which the legislative body is a town meeting, waive property taxes 
and interest related thereto which may be due for any tax year with respect to real or 
personal property held by any person, firm or corporation for the purpose of creating 
or furnishing a supply of water for domestic use, exclusive of any such property (1) 
owned by a municipal corporation or (2) used by any such person, firm or corporation 
in creating or furnishing such a supply of water for purposes of profit related to such 
use, with such profit inuring to such person or the owners of such firm or corporation.
      (P.A. 83-563, S. 2.)
